Hallie Jackson, she is an American politician and journalist. She is currently working as the White House Correspondent for NBC News as well as anchoring various MSNBC news channels (cable division NBC). Jackson was raised and educated in Pennsylvania. In her university, John Hopkins University, she obtained a bachelor's degree in Political Sciences. Jackson spent a few years in Maryland, Delaware and Connecticut at the CBS-affiliated TV stations WBOC and WFSB. She then was hired by Hearst Corporation in Washington DC and was responsible for all 26 of their stations across the United States. Then she was hired by NBC News in 2014 and spent one year at the NBC Los Angeles station. In the following years, with her outstanding reporting of the various campaigns and the 2016 presidential elections she earned an image as a dedicated journalist for the political world. The journalist is well-known and respected. is hardworking and versatile. One of her biggest assignments were exclusive interviews, as well as the coverage of Ted Cruz's presidential run. Jackson joined NBC's White House chief correspondent in 2017. Jackson is married Douglas Hitchner.
